WebA check pilot (or check airman) is an aircraft pilot who performs an oversight, safety, and qualification role for commercial pilots undergoing evaluation. [1] [2] The role of the check pilot is to ensure that the flight crew member has met competency standards before the check airman releases the crew member from training and to ensure that those standards …

Web(1) A check airman (aircraft) is a person who is qualified to conduct flight checks in an aircraft, in a flight simulator, or in a flight training device for a particular type aircraft. Due to the extraordinary challenges of COVID-19, the FAA published this Special Federal Aviation Regulation (SFAR) today, providing relief for training, recency, checking, testing, duration, and renewal requirements for pilots under Part 61 and Part 91.

You don't need to complete a 24 month flight review if you've passed a practical test or pilot proficiency check conducted by an examiner, an approved pilot check airman, or a U.S. Armed Force, for a pilot certificate, rating, or operating privilege. ... crypto wallet watcher
